#ifndef _MISCFS_UNION_H_
#define _MISCFS_UNION_H_
struct union_args {
char *target; /* Target of loopback */
int mntflags; /* Options on the mount */
};
#define UNMNT_ABOVE 0x0001 /* Target appears below mount point */
#define UNMNT_BELOW 0x0002 /* Target appears below mount point */
#define UNMNT_REPLACE 0x0003 /* Target replaces mount point */
#define UNMNT_OPMASK 0x0003
#define UNMNT_BITS "\177\20" \
"b\00above\0b\01below\0b\02replace\0"
#ifdef _KERNEL
struct union_mount {
struct vnode *um_uppervp;
struct vnode *um_lowervp;
kauth_cred_t um_cred; /* Credentials of user calling mount */
int um_cmode; /* cmask from mount process */
int um_op; /* Operation mode */
};
/*
* DEFDIRMODE is the mode bits used to create a shadow directory.
*/
#define UN_DIRMODE (S_IRWXU|S_IRWXG|S_IRWXO)
#define UN_FILEMODE (S_IRUSR|S_IWUSR|S_IRGRP|S_IWGRP|S_IROTH|S_IWOTH)
/*
* A cache of vnode references.
* Lock requirements are:
*
* : stable
* c unheadlock[hash]
* l un_lock
* m un_lock or vnode lock to read, un_lock and
* exclusive vnode lock to write
* v vnode lock to read, exclusive vnode lock to write
*
* Lock order is vnode then un_lock.
*/
struct union_node {
kmutex_t un_lock;
LIST_ENTRY(union_node) un_cache; /* c: Hash chain */
int un_refs; /* c: Reference counter */
struct mount *un_mount; /* c: union mount */
struct vnode *un_vnode; /* :: Back pointer */
struct vnode *un_uppervp; /* m: overlaying object */
struct vnode *un_lowervp; /* v: underlying object */
struct vnode *un_dirvp; /* v: Parent dir of uppervp */
struct vnode *un_pvp; /* v: Parent vnode */
char *un_path; /* v: saved component name */
int un_openl; /* v: # of opens on lowervp */
unsigned int un_cflags; /* c: cache flags */
bool un_hooknode; /* :: from union_readdirhook */
struct vnode **un_dircache; /* v: cached union stack */
off_t un_uppersz; /* l: size of upper object */
off_t un_lowersz; /* l: size of lower object */
};
#define UN_CACHED 0x10 /* In union cache */
extern int union_allocvp(struct vnode **, struct mount *,
struct vnode *, struct vnode *,
struct componentname *, struct vnode *,
struct vnode *, int);
extern int union_check_rmdir(struct union_node *, kauth_cred_t);
extern int union_copyfile(struct vnode *, struct vnode *, kauth_cred_t,
struct lwp *);
extern int union_copyup(struct union_node *, int, kauth_cred_t,
struct lwp *);
extern void union_diruncache(struct union_node *);
extern int union_dowhiteout(struct union_node *, kauth_cred_t);
extern int union_mkshadow(struct union_mount *, struct vnode *,
struct componentname *, struct vnode **);
extern int union_mkwhiteout(struct union_mount *, struct vnode *,
struct componentname *, struct union_node *);
extern int union_vn_create(struct vnode **, struct union_node *,
struct lwp *);
extern int union_cn_close(struct vnode *, int, kauth_cred_t,
struct lwp *);
extern void union_removed_upper(struct union_node *un);
extern struct vnode *union_lowervp(struct vnode *);
extern void union_newsize(struct vnode *, off_t, off_t);
int union_readdirhook(struct vnode **, struct file *, struct lwp *);
VFS_PROTOS(union);
#define MOUNTTOUNIONMOUNT(mp) ((struct union_mount *)((mp)->mnt_data))
#define VTOUNION(vp) ((struct union_node *)(vp)->v_data)
#define UNIONTOV(un) ((un)->un_vnode)
#define LOWERVP(vp) (VTOUNION(vp)->un_lowervp)
#define UPPERVP(vp) (VTOUNION(vp)->un_uppervp)
#define OTHERVP(vp) (UPPERVP(vp) ? UPPERVP(vp) : LOWERVP(vp))
#define LOCKVP(vp) (UPPERVP(vp) ? UPPERVP(vp) : (vp))
extern int (**union_vnodeop_p)(void *);
void union_init(void);
void union_reinit(void);
void union_done(void);
int union_freevp(struct vnode *);
#endif /* _KERNEL */
#endif /* _MISCFS_UNION_H_ */
